Why professional cleaning is important


Area rugs can accumulate dirt, allergens, and stains over time, which not only affect their appearance but also indoor air quality. Professional cleaning services have the expertise and equipment to effectively remove deep-seated dirt and contaminants, which typical home cleaning methods might miss. Regular professional cleaning helps preserve the rug's colors and fibers, ensuring they look great for years.
 

Key factors to consider when choosing a cleaning service


When selecting an area rug cleaning service, there are several factors you should consider to ensure you choose a reliable and skilled provider.
 

Experience and expertise


One of the first things to look for in a cleaning service is their experience and expertise in handling area rugs. Different rugs, such as Persian, Oriental, or synthetic, require specific cleaning techniques. A reputable service will have knowledge of these techniques and the appropriate cleaning products for each type of rug. Ask about their experience with your specific rug type and whether they use eco-friendly and non-toxic cleaning products.
 

Reputation and reviews


Researching a company's reputation is crucial. Look for reviews and testimonials from previous customers to get an idea of their service quality and customer satisfaction. You can find reviews on the company's website, social media pages, or third-party review sites. Additionally, ask for references from the company, and consider contacting previous clients to inquire about their experiences.
 

Certification and insurance


Ensure that the cleaning service you choose is certified by a recognized organization in the industry, such as the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C). Certification indicates that the company adheres to industry standards and employs trained technicians. Additionally, check if the company is insured, which protects your property in case of any damage during the cleaning process.
 

Cleaning process and techniques


It's important to understand the cleaning process and techniques a company uses. Ask about the methods they employ, such as steam cleaning, dry cleaning, or hand washing. Some rugs may require specialized treatments, so ensure the company can accommodate any special needs. Additionally, inquire whether they offer additional services like stain protection, deodorizing, or repairs.
 

Preparing your rug for professional cleaning


Before sending your rug to a professional cleaning service, there are a few steps you can take to prepare it.
 

Inspect and document your rug


Before handing over your rug, inspect it for any pre-existing damage, such as stains, fraying, or color fading. Take clear photographs of the rug from different angles and document any issues you observe. This will serve as a record in case of any disputes or damage claims after the cleaning.
 

Remove loose debris


While the cleaning service will perform a thorough cleaning, it's helpful to remove loose dirt and debris from the rug beforehand. Gently vacuum both sides of the rug to remove dust and loose particles. Avoid using a vacuum with a beater bar, as it can damage delicate fibers.
 

Communicate specific concerns


If there are specific stains or areas of concern on your rug, communicate these to the cleaning service. Inform them about the nature of the stain and any attempts you’ve made to clean it. This information can help them tailor their cleaning approach to effectively address the issue.
 

Check for insect infestation


Rugs, especially those made of natural fibers, can be susceptible to insect infestations like moths. Inspect your rug for signs of damage or insect activity, such as holes or larvae. If you suspect an infestation, inform the cleaning service so they can take appropriate measures.
